Résumé

This Regulation, of 16 Sections and one Annex, gives definitions and makes provisions for drilling procedures. Section (1) gives definitions. Section (2) provides for drilling works to be operated within three months from drilling license date. Sections (3), (4), (7) and (8) provide for a one month test-drawing to be operated within one year from license date. The Water Governor can decide to extend the abovementioned periods. The operator must inform the governor seven days before test-drawing date and governor will give instructions regarding the drawing modality. After test-drawing the operator must compose a drawing report regarding the test containing maps, samples and documents. Section (4) and (5) provide for measuring and diary procedures. Section (9) to (11) deal with water drawing and measurement equipment to be mounted 30 days after test-drawing has been terminated and upon governor authorization. Sections (12) to (14) provide for information and modules procedures. A drilling license must be held by the operator for inspection purposes. Section (15) provide for license taxes and levies as reported in Annex 1. Section (16) gives general information.
